How they compare

Indonesia currently reports 57,597 t against 57,346 t in Northern Africa, a difference of 251 t.

The two have swapped places 11 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Northern Africa ahead.

Indonesia ranks 18th and Northern Africa ranks 16th of 186 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Indonesia averaged higher in 2 and Northern Africa in 5.

The Cropland Nutrient balance domain contains information on the flows of n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ium from mineral fertilizer, manure applied, atmospheric deposition, crop removal, and biological fixation over cropland and per unit area of cropland. The flows are aggregated to total inputs and total outputs, from which the overall nutrient balance and nutrient use efficiency on cropland are calculated. Statistics are disseminated in units of tonnes and in kg/ha, as appropriate. Nutrient use efficiency is expressed as a fraction (%).
